Ensure that welding foremen and quality assurance personnel thoroughly understand the boundaries of your active WPSs. If a welder changes a parameters outside the permitted range on a production line, the entire weldment could be rejected during a third-party audit. welding standard asme

Mark all production welds with the unique stamp or identification number of the welder who performed the work. This establishes accountability and allows for rapid root-cause analysis if non-destructive testing (NDT) reveals a defect.

To successfully execute an ASME-compliant weld, Section IX mandates a strict three-step documentation and qualification lifecycle: the Welding Procedure Specification (WPS), the Procedure Qualification Record (PQR), and the Welder Performance Qualification (WPQ). If there is a criticism to be leveled at Section IX, it is that it can be overly prescriptive regarding administrative details while occasionally lagging behind emerging technologies. For example, the qualification requirements for newer processes like Laser Beam Welding (LBW) or additive manufacturing (3D printing of metals) have required significant updates to catch up with industry innovation. While the 2021 and 2023 editions have made strides here, the code is inherently conservative, prioritizing proven safety over cutting-edge convenience.
